This article contains the best free online high school courses in Ontario. Are you in search of something like this? Look no further. I advise that you read through with undivided attention so you can gain full insights about the topic.
Have you ever imagined that those courses you take offline in high school can also be taught online? Oh, you didn’t know? Well, you are here now.
One of the beautiful things technology did was to introduce online learning platforms that make it possible for us to learn anything from any place at any time. What I mean is this; you can stay in your house in Massachusetts and take courses offered by Ontario universities.
It is not magical. It is possible through virtual learning platforms. Now, some of these courses may cost a fortune to sign up for or enroll in. Majority of people have abandoned their dreams of taking courses due to the cost. However, there is a way out. Want to know the way? Follow me.
The way out is that some governments, organizations, and high schools have sponsored some of the courses, thereby making it free for anyone who wishes to enroll in the course. This is why today, you see things like free online geology courses, food safety online courses offered freely, and many others.
In this article, we will be exploring the various best free online high school courses in Ontario. I urge you to follow me closely as I unveil all you need to know about them such as their requirements, duration, etc.
If you have someone interested in becoming an aerospace engineer, point the person to this free online course for aerospace engineering. It can be a starting point.
What are the Benefits of Non-Credit Online High School Courses?
The benefits of taking non-credit online high school courses are as follows;
- You tend to have an awesome learning experience due to the nature of the course.
- You don’t worry about the stress of deadlines and graded assignments.
- You are not faced with the potential academic consequences of failure.
- You can learn at your own pace.
Now, you must understand that non-credit courses are courses that lead to self-development and professional needs. It has nothing to do with college degree programs.

Free Online High School Courses in Ontario
Below are the best free online high school courses in Ontario that you can take. I will list and give a brief so that you can gain full insights about them.
It is important to note that our data is obtained from deep research about the topic on trusted sources, and individual school websites.
- Preparing for Grade 9 Math
- Developing Effective Learning Skills
- Grade 12 English (ENG4C)
- Mathematics of Data Management (MDM4U)
- Fostering Digital Literacy
- Supporting Mental Health
- Grade 11 Physics (SPH3U)
- Grade 9 Science (SNC1D)
- University Writing Preparation
- Environmental Science
1. Preparing for Grade 9 Math
This is the first on our list of free online high school courses in Ontario. It is offered by Ontario Virtual School, and it aims at preparing grade 8 students for their transition to high school-level math. This course explores all the mathematical concepts related to algebra, analytical geometry, measurement, and geometry.
It is offered online, and you can start at any time, and learn at your own pace. Upon successful completion of this course, you must have learned the underlying skills to bridge the gap between elementary school and high school math, understand the daily applications of math in life journey & its importance, etc.
It is free. Use the link below to get started.
2. Developing Effective Learning Skills
This is the next course on our list. It is offered too by Ontario Virtual School and is free of charge. The course explores the basic skills needed to effectively prepare for tests and assignments. It also teaches the five different note-taking methods and how students can discover their preferred style.
Upon completion of this course, you must have learned long-term planning, reading and note taking, study skills and test-taking, writing strategies, how to be an active eLearning student, and many others. It is important to note that this course will not earn you a high school credit as it is considered a general interest course only.
3. Grade 12 English (ENG4C)
Grade 12 English (ENG4C) is a free online high school course offered by Tvo Learn. It is a college preparation course that explores the consolidation of literacy, communication, critical and creative thinking skills required for excellent performance in academics and daily life.
This course is designed for independent study and has about 15 modules. Upon successful completion of the course, you must have gotten prepared for college or the workplace. Use the link below to get started.
4. Mathematics of Data Management (MDM4U)
This is also one of the courses that you can enroll freely in Ontario. It broadens your comprehension of mathematics as it relates to managing data. You will learn the methods of organizing and analyzing large amounts of information, mathematical processes required for excelling in senior mathematics, etc.
If you have plans to study courses like business, social sciences, and humanities in the university, this course will simply help you to get started. This course has 22 lessons and is designed for independent study. Use the link below to get started.
5. Fostering Digital Literacy
Fostering Digital Literacy is a course that explores how to use various online tools to make research easier and faster. You will be taught how to properly communicate through email, the dangers of plagiarism, etc.
Upon successful completion of this course, you must have learned netiquette, plagiarism prevention, checking internet validity, proper internet research, and many others. It is offered by Ontario Virtual School. Use the link below to get started.
6. Supporting Mental Health
Supporting Mental Health course teaches the benefits of practicing good mental health throughout high school. It explores how to create a digital brand and as well protect yourself online. You will learn the usage of social platforms for professional purposes, and how to manage the risks involved in these platforms.
This course extensively explains all you need to know about social media protection, self-management, crisis prevention, dealing with digital bullying, the development of eLearning skills, and many others. It is good to note that this course will not earn you a high school credit. Get started with the link below.
7. Grade 11 Physics (SPH3U)
This is also one of the online high school courses in Ontario that you can take freely. It is offered by tvo Learn and aims to help you develop your comprehension of basic concepts of physics. You will learn kinematics, linear motion, different kinds of forces, energy transformations, etc.
This course is designed for independent study and has about 29 lessons. Use the link below to get started.
8. Grade 9 Science (SNC1D)
Grade 9 Science (SNC1D) explores the basic concepts of biology, chemistry, earth and space science, physics, and many others. It relates science to technology, society, and the environment, and also helps you develop your skills in scientific investigation processes.
This course has 22 lessons, and upon completion, you must have acquired an understanding of scientific theories, atomic and molecular structures, properties of elements and compounds, and many others. Use the link below to get started.
9. University Writing Preparation
University Writing Preparation is a course that teaches you how to develop your writing skills through the various writing activities that you will engage in while in post-secondary studies. The course is offered free of charge by Ontario Virtual School.
It explains in detail all you need to know about essay writing, research papers, workplace writing, university assignments, and many others. It is good to know that this course is a non-credit course, however, it will be very helpful to grade 12 students.
10. Environmental Science
This course explores how human activities affect the environment, human health, energy conservation, and resource management. It provides you with skills relating to environmental science that will help you thrive in both the workplace and life after secondary school.
This course emphasizes practical application and relevant topics in environmental science. It has about 30 lessons and is designed for independent study. Use the link below to get started.
Conclusion
These courses I listed above are not just online high school courses in Ontario, but the best free ones you can find. Enrolling in any of them helps to broaden/ deepen your knowledge in the field.
I wish you the best of luck as you enroll and start your lessons.
Recommendations
- Free Online Safety Courses With Certificates
. - Best Free Online Montessori Training
. - Free Online High Schools In Texas
. - Free Online History Courses
. - Best Free Online GED Classes